What this strategy is

High Conviction Strategy aim to generate outsize returns, over 3 - 5 years period, through a diversified midcap biased multicap portfolio with 20 - 25 most compelling investment ideas. Multi-cap portfolio with judicious allocation to large, mid and small cap based on their return potential. Portfolio Adhering to'Must 5' Investment Framework.

What is Nippon - High Conviction Equity HCEP?

Nippon - High Conviction Equity HCEP is a Multi Cap PMS strategy from Nippon, managed by Varun Goel. It follows a Growth style, is benchmarked to the S&P BSE 500 Total Return Index, and carries a Nyra score of 5.6/10.

Who should consider Nippon - High Conviction Equity HCEP?

It suits investors with a five-year-plus horizon who want active Multi Cap exposure and can stay invested through market drawdowns. The SEBI minimum is ₹50 L.

What returns has it delivered?

Since inception (Mar 2014) it has compounded at roughly 15.8% a year, with a 3-year CAGR of 13.2% against 12.5% for the S&P BSE 500 Total Return Index. Returns are net of fees; past performance is not a guarantee of future results.

What are the fees and lock-in?

2.50% fixed, with a performance fee of Performance-linked. Exit / lock-in terms: Exit Load: 1 Year: 2.00%, 2 Year: 0.00%, 3 Year: 0.00%.
